How to Mute a User During a WhatsApp Group Call

You can mute any participant during an active WhatsApp group call on both Android and iOS devices.

Follow these simple steps:

  1. Open WhatsApp on your Android or iPhone
  2. Join or start a group voice call
  3. On the call screen, you will see profile icons of all participants
  4. Tap and hold on the profile picture of the person you want to mute
  5. Select the Mute option

Once muted, that participant’s audio will no longer be audible to you, improving call clarity.

How to Send a Private Message During a Group Call

Sometimes muting alone is not enough. You may want to inform the person why they were muted or ask them something privately without disturbing the call.

Steps to send a message during a group call:

  1. While on the group call, tap and hold the participant’s profile icon
  2. Choose the Message option
  3. A private chat window will open
  4. Type and send your message normally

This message is sent privately and is not visible to other call participants.

Additional WhatsApp Group Call Features You Should Know

  • WhatsApp allows free group voice calls with up to 32 users
  • The person who adds you to the call appears first on the call screen
  • Incoming group calls show all active participants
  • Call history is saved under the Calls tab
  • You can view individual participants by tapping call history
  • If you miss a group call that is still active, you can join it later

These features make WhatsApp group calling flexible and user-friendly.
